Et si l'uchronie était une bonne raison de lire de l'imaginaire ?Nous avons posé la question à Karine Gobled et Bertrand Campeis, co-auteurs du Guide de l'Uchronie et membre du Prix Actusf de l'uchronie. Un entretien dans le cadre du livre "Pourquoi Lire de la Science-fiction et de la Fantasy ? (et aller chez son libraire)". Hébergé par Ausha.
